Hey on-call: when the Copperfen read-replica lag alarm fires, your first question should be "which build is the replicator running?" — half the time someone shipped a Driftline release that changed batch sizes and nobody updated the runbook. Every replicator deploy is stamped with a provenance token at build time, so you can trace the exact artifact back to its pipeline run. Check the alarm payload, then match it against the stamp. For reference, the current production replicator was stamped with the token below.

build token for kagaf-hahof: htk14_9d3d4d26d7d8de

Account recovery — Nightfill scheduler (Korvette Systems). If the nightfill service account is locked after failed backfill auth, do not reset via the admin console; that invalidates queued jobs. Instead, pause the scheduler, confirm the last successful backfill window in the audit log, then initiate recovery from the Nightfill ops host. Recovery requires the standing passphrase held by the on-call lead. For review purposes, the current recovery passphrase is recorded directly below.

strongbox words: sorir-belvan-rusix-ulays-ralmir-praix-eliir-tamax-praael-druael-julir-tamius-jorir

### Step 3 — Drift Correction Service

The Verdanthaus controller recalibrates humidity sensors nightly because the Pellon probes drift about 2% per week. Set `DRIFT_WINDOW_HOURS=24` and `DRIFT_MAX_CORRECTION=0.05` — anything bigger and you're masking a dying sensor, not fixing drift. Calibration baselines come from the Greenvault reference service, and fetching them needs credentials, so add this line to the controller's `.env` before restarting:

sealed setting: ARCHIVE_KEY3=8d0

Ticket: Staging env misconfigured for Siftgate bloom filter

The bloom layer in front of the Pellet KV store is rejecting all lookups in staging because the env file was copied from the dev template without credentials. False-positive tuning values are fine; only the auth line is missing. To unblock the weekly demo, the Pellet admission secret must be set on the following line.

env line for yaguf-fajop: LEDGER_TOKEN13=fb08984397349